Fair play when re-drawing election boundaries: Gen Y voters
Assistant Professor Eugene Tan from SMU, said: "Singapore voters would be more concerned with fair play in the political system, it is something the government would have to pay attention to and something which the opposition parties can easily pick on.
"Singaporeans want to see a fair contest where parties are not unnecessarily advantaged or disadvantaged through the rules in place." Full story
